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)
Parkwood violent crime is 14.8. (The US average is 22.7)
Parkwood property crime is 52.1. (The US average is 35.4)
NOTE: The city of Parkwood, Washington does not have FBI Crime Statistics. The closest similar sized city with FBI crime data is the city of Normandy Park, Washington.
